2015 is your chance to grow fresh, healthy, and delicious produce with your own two hands and also help feed the hungry in our community at the same time.
Squash Patch Farm Ministry in cooperation with many local
churches and other organizations are in the process of establishing a new
method of helping to feed the hungry here in the Chino Valley, AZ area. Our
approach is not the Re-creation of the Wheel. What we are doing is a two fold
approach to an age old problem. The first part of the program is the
development of a Community
Garden in which local residents
may participate.
In conjunction with this part of the program we will be
encouraging any resident in the community who either currently has a garden or
plans to have on this year to donate their excess production to the Community Garden program. The combines produce
grown will be distributed to those in our community who are in need of food
assistance. Those involved in the program will also have access to additional
training we will be offering.
